UN expressed concern over new restrictions on working with children in Belarus
A group of UN Special Rapporteurs has addressed the regime in Belarus regarding the draft law “On Amendments to Laws on Ensuring Children’s Rights”, which passed its first reading. Under this bill, individuals convicted of “extremist crimes” would be barred from engaging in teaching or holding positions involving regular work with children.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ya honored the memory of Belarusians who fought for Italy’s freedom
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ya visited Italy ahead of an important historical milestone – the 80th anniversary of the country’s liberation from fascism. Belarusians also took part in this struggle. 81 years ago, 264 Belarusian soldiers lost their lives in the Battle of Monte Cassino. Summary of the first day of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ya’s visit to Italy: Florence
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ya visited Florence during her official trip to Italy. The leader met with Mayor Sara Funaro, who awarded her the Seal of Peace. This award, established in the 15th century in Florence, recognizes individuals who contribute to peace and human rights. Previous recipients include the Dalai Lama and Daisaku Ikeda.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ya met with Nobel laureate Svetlana Alexievich
Svetlana Alexievich is the first Belarusian writer to receive the Nobel Prize in Literature. In 2015, the Swedish Academy honored her “for her polyphonic writings, a monument to suffering and courage in our time”.
